Alonso acquitted of tax fraud
MADRID: Former Liverpool midfielder Xabi Alonso has been acquitted of tax fraud, a Madrid court announced on Tuesday. The prosecutors had initially demanded for him to face five years in jail before halving their request. Alonso, a World Cup winner with Spain in 2010, was accused of using a company based on the Portuguese island of Madeira to avoid paying 2 million euros ($2.2 million) in taxes on his image rights to the Spanish authorities. Prosecutors said the fraud took place between 2010 and 2012 when he was playing for Real Madrid.
